Taxonomic Classification

Rank Felten-Kleinwühlmaus Broken Hill Gidgee
Kingdom Animalia (Tier) Plantae (Pflanzen)
Phylum Chordata (Chordatiere)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Mammalia (Säugetiere) Magnoliopsida (Dicots)
Order Rodentia (Nagetiere) Fabales (Schmetterlingsblütenartige)
Family Cricetidae Fabaceae
Genus Microtus Acacia
Species Microtus felteni Acacia loderi
